Output 49496ef0ba4bf7971639109047ee80aaeb2cdbe054ecfe66aa3a99a632aec881:0

value
122230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f2a2e08e7e2d523b34488fe812a13330ed62727 OP_EQUAL
address
38ubqQNrZ6DmfcszzNUrfhk52cCkKL66Ex
transaction
49496ef0ba4bf7971639109047ee80aaeb2cdbe054ecfe66aa3a99a632aec881
confirmations
254854
spent
true